Summary: The classroom teacher supervises students within the classroom and throughout the building and campus during the school day. The classroom teacher creates and delivers lesson plans to students, based on state tested standards and guidelines. This person collects , records, and analyzes academic data and performance throughout the school year. The classroom teacher aligns lessons with those of other teachers. This person also regularly communicates the academic, behavioral, and social emotional progress of students to their families. This person will adhere to the school’s mission, vision and values.

Essential duties:

  • Provides all students an education that covers all academic standards for the course taught.
  • Creates a culture of the highest behavioral expectations.
  • Teaches courses assigned by their principal/supervisor which are aligned to their licensure area; including specialized subjects such as math, science or literacy as well as chosen electives which are structured on the humanities, community, and real-world knowledge and skills.
  • Uses appropriate techniques and strategies which promote and enhance critical, creative and evaluative thinking capabilities of students.
  • Participates in personal and professional growth activities focused on the acquisition of new and improved skills and knowledge.
  • Prepares course objectives and outlines for course of study following the North Carolina Standard Course of Study, curriculum guidelines, or requirements of the state and the school.
  • Guides the learning process toward the achievement of standards-based instruction and in accordance with goals established by the state of North Carolina.
  • Delivers and communicates clear objectives for all lessons to students. Creates lesson plans for all substitute teachers.
  • Instructs students as a class whole, in groups, and individually. Uses a variety of methods to instruct students (i.e. visuals, online lessons, hard copy lessons)
  • Develops and presents differentiated lessons to meet the academic needs of all students
  • Assists the administration in establishing a set of school/classroom rules consistent with that of the school, and provides fair and constant classroom management.
  • Schedules/attends meetings with families to discuss the academic and behavioral needs of students.
  • Prepares materials and classrooms for class activities.
  • Observes and assesses students’ performance, behavior, social development, and physical health on a regular basis.
  • Prepares and delivers tutoring lessons to students who in need of extra assistance
  • Creates, administers, and grades tests/quizzes and assignments to assess students’ progress
  • Assigns and grades class work and homework.
  • Contacts and meets with families, staff, and administrators to resolve various student issues.
  • Leads students through all safety drills (i.e. fire, lockdown, shelter)
  • Administers/proctors state exams in accordance with appropriate rules and regulations.
  • Attends all required meetings (staff, professional development, data, safety procedure, etc.).
  • Keeps all records required by the school including intervention plans, 504 plans, and IEP’s.
  • Supervises students during hallway transitions, afterschool pickup lines, and at lunch/recess.
  • Covers classes for co-workers when absent
  • Carries out daily assigned duty (i.e. parking lot set up, lunch duty, etc.)
  • Appraises students’ effectiveness and demonstrates successful application of skills and information required to increase effectiveness and strives to maintain and improve professional effectiveness.
  • Uses appropriate differentiated instructional strategies and materials that reflect each student’s culture, learning styles, special needs, and socioeconomic backgrounds.
  • Adheres to intervention plans, 504 plans and IEP’s.
  • Performs related job duties as assigned.
